Acorn Impact Workshops & Insite Sessions
Acorn Impact Workshops and Insite Sessions offer jobseekers expert advice on re-entering the workforce, with each session focusing on a different sector. At our launch, leading companies like Smiths and Maximus joined a special event highlighting opportunities in manufacturing and production.

Reconstruct Programme
The Reconstruct Programme helps individuals with convictions find employment. In partnership with HMPPS, we work in Welsh prisons and HMP Bristol to prepare individuals for construction roles as they approach the end of their sentence.
